Checking Credentials and References
When looking for an office renovation contractor, begin by checking credentials. Ensure that the contractor is licensed, insured, and bonded, which protects you in case of accidents or damages during construction. Request references from past clients and follow up to discuss their experiences. Look for reviews or testimonials to gauge the contractor’s reliability, quality of work, and ability to meet deadlines.

Common Challenges in Office Renovation
Budget Constraints
Controlling renovation costs is one of the most significant challenges in any project. Unexpected expenses can arise from unforeseen structural issues, design changes, or fluctuations in material prices. It’s essential to set a realistic budget that includes contingencies. A competent Office renovation contractor Austin can help detect potential issues early and adjust plans proactively to minimize financial impact.
Timeline Delays
Delays can result from various factors, such as delayed material orders, subcontractor availability, or regulatory holdups. Establishing a clear timeline during planning is vital, and maintaining communication throughout the project can help manage expectations. Should delays occur, a professional contractor will work to adjust schedules and keep the project moving forward.

How Long Does an Office Renovation Take?
The duration of an office renovation can vary widely based on the project’s scope. Minor renovations can take a few weeks, while more extensive designs can last several months. A detailed timeline will be provided during the planning phase.
What Are Typical Costs Involved?
Costs can fluctuate based on project size, materials, and labor. Generally, small renovations can start from $50,000, while larger projects might exceed $250,000. An accurate estimate will be provided after consultation and site assessment.
Can I Stay in the Office During Renovation?
Staying in the office during renovations is possible but depends on the project’s scale. If major work occurs, it might be best to relocate temporarily for safety and comfort. Consult with your contractor to determine the best approach.
